About Legacy Ridge

Legacy Ridge is one of Westminster's more established master-planned neighborhoods, organized around the Legacy Ridge Golf Course — a well-regarded municipal course that gives the community its name and much of its character. Many homes sit along or near the course and its associated open space, giving the neighborhood a green, spacious feel.

Westminster occupies a practical spot in the north metro area, roughly between Denver and Boulder, and Legacy Ridge benefits from that positioning. Highway access via US-36 and I-25 makes commuting in multiple directions manageable, and the neighborhood is within reach of the employment and retail growth that has reshaped the north-metro corridor.

The housing in Legacy Ridge is predominantly single-family, built largely from the 1990s and 2000s, in the range of sizes and styles typical of golf-course communities of that era. The neighborhood operates with HOA amenities and the open-space access that comes with a planned community built around a course.

The neighborhood has the mature, established landscape of a community past its build-out phase — grown-in trees and a settled streetscape.

Westminster as a whole has invested in reshaping its identity in recent years — the long-running effort to build a new downtown on the former Westminster Mall site is the most visible example — and that broader civic momentum is part of the area's trajectory.
